Project 37 - Segment Animation "K-12 JUNO STEM KIT"


K-12 JUNO STEM KIT



What You Can Build Using K-12 JUNO STEM KIT

The "Segment Animation" project lets learners create an eye-catching illusion by controlling parts of a 7-segment display with slide toggle switches. By turning switches ON and OFF, different segments light up to simulate movement or animation, teaching basic display control and timing.



What You Can Learn

  • Segment Control: Understand how each segment of a 7-segment display operates independently using switches.

  • Visual Perception: Explore how sequential lighting creates the illusion of animation and movement.

  • Circuit Timing: Build skills in switching circuits and learn how timing affects observed effects.

Real Life Problem Solving

  • Display Technology: Helps understand how digital displays show numbers and symbols through segment control.

  • Visual Interfaces: Demonstrates animation concepts used in digital clocks, calculators, and signage.

  • Creative Electronics: Encourages experimentation with light sequencing and user control.

Applications and Extensions

  • Program microcontrollers to automate segment animations.

  • Design number patterns or letters for custom displays.

  • Use LED strips or dot matrix displays to expand animation options.


Skills Developed

  • Working with multi-segment displays and switch-based controls.

  • Developing timing and sequencing logic for animations.

  • Creative thinking in visual design and electronics integration.


Real-Life Benefits

  • Visual Communication: Builds understanding of how electronic displays convey information visually.

  • Creative STEM Applications: Encourages blending electronics with art and design in technology projects.

  • Problem Solving: Fosters logical thinking for controlling multi-part devices.



Why This Project Matters

The Segment Animation project bridges the gap between static circuits and dynamic visual effects. It introduces learners to the basics of display control and animation, essential in devices like clocks, meters, and digital signs. Through hands-on interaction, students gain a foundation for exploring more complex display technologies.


Project 37: Segment Animation empowers students with the creative and technical know-how to bring static electronics to life with motion and animation illusions.
